1. What is MRS Agar used for?

MRS Agar is used for the selective growth and isolation of Lactobacillus species in microbiological research and educational settings.

2. Is MRS Agar suitable for academic use?

Yes, MRS Agar is widely used in academic settings for teaching and research purposes due to its reliability and high purity.

3. What are the storage conditions for MRS Agar?

MRS Agar should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ture to maintain its quality and effectiveness.

4. Can MRS Agar be used for other bacteria besides Lactobacillus?

MRS Agar is specifically formulated for the growth of Lactobacillus species and may not be suitable for other types of bacteria.

5. How is MRS Agar prepared for use?

MRS Agar is prepared by dissolving the granulated powder in distilled water, boiling to ensure complete dissolution, and then sterilizing by autoclaving before pouring into petri dishes or test tubes.
